Subject: Re: [RFC][PATCH] proc: export more page flags in /proc/kpageflags
Date: Tue, 14 Apr 2009 16:42:17 +0900 (JST)	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20090414163312.C674.A69D9226@jp.fujitsu.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20090414072231.GA7001@localhost>


> > > > > - PG_unevictable
> > > > > - PG_mlocked
>  
> How about including PG_unevictable/PG_mlocked?
> They shall be meaningful to administrators.

I explained another mail. please see it.


> > this 9 flags shouldn't exported.
> > I can't imazine administrator use what purpose those flags.
> 
> > > > > - PG_swapcache
> > > > > - PG_swapbacked
> > > > > - PG_poison
> > > > > - PG_compound
> >
> > I can agree this 4 flags.
> > However pagemap lack's hugepage considering.
> > if PG_compound exporting, we need more work.
> 
> You mean to fold PG_head/PG_tail into PG_COMPOUND?
> Yes, that's a good simplification for end users.

Yes, I agree.


> > > > > - PG_NOPAGE: whether the page is present
> > 
> > PM_NOT_PRESENT isn't enough?
> 
> That would not be usable if you are going to do a system wide scan.
> PG_NOPAGE could help differentiate the 'no page' case from 'no flags'
> case.
> 
> However PG_NOPAGE is more about the last resort. The system wide scan
> can be made much more efficient if we know the exact memory layouts.

Yup :)
